Heaven Cries for Your Wrongdoings: Warning to Singapore Police
(Clearwisdom.net) On the morning of April 14, Singapore practitioners
protested outside the Chinese Embassy against the CCP's atrocities of harvesting
organs from living Chinese practitioners. The Singapore police confiscated
practitioners' posters and banners. This is the third time that the police have
interfered in this manner. When it happened, the clear sky suddenly turned to
rain. Practitioners told policemen at the site, "Heaven is crying for your
wrongdoings." At 10:15 a.m. on April 14, Singapore practitioners came to the Chinese
Embassy as usual. They opened up banners describing the CCP's atrocities of
killing practitioners for their organs and set up posters. In just a little
while, five plainclothes policemen approached. They claimed that practitioners
didn't apply for permission for public activities and wanted to confiscate the
banners and posters. Just after their claim, the clear skies turned to rain.
Practitioners then warned the policemen, "Look, heaven is crying for your
wrongdoing. You should not do this. The CCP is massacring practitioners and you
should have joined us to rescue them. You are now helping the killers and you
are committing a crime." One of the policemen said repeatedly, "You know that we are ordered to
do this and we cannot do anything." Practitioners then told them, "Though it is your supervisor who gave you
this order, you are accountable for carrying out the order. You know that those
who took orders to kill Jewish people were also tried after World War II. Where
is your conscience? "One day, your children will ask you, 'When Falun Gong practitioners
were being persecuted and killed, many people were trying to rescue them, what
were you doing?' How will you reply to them? You should think over this issue
and ask your conscience what you are doing and whether it is right." The head police officers listened to practitioners' warning quietly with
reddened eyes. The rained continued until practitioners finished sending righteous thoughts
